Planning Stage

The planning stage involves setting up your calendar and creating a comprehensive schedule for your project milestones. Consider the following steps:
– Identify your project milestones and assign specific dates to each task
– Determine the required resources and allocate them accordingly
– Set realistic deadlines and establish a communication plan for stakeholders
– Develop a contingency plan to address potential risks or setbacks

Tracking Stage

The tracking stage requires constant monitoring of your project’s progress. Regularly update your calendar with the following information:
– Status updates for each milestone
– Task assignments and completion dates
– Resource utilization and allocation
– Potential risks or setbacks and their mitigation strategies

Evaluation Stage

The evaluation stage involves assessing the project’s performance and identifying areas for improvement. Consider the following steps:
– Review your calendar and evaluate the project’s progress
– Compare actual results with planned milestones and deadlines
– Identify areas where the project deviated from the plan and analyze the reasons behind these deviations
– Develop recommendations for future projects based on lessons learned from this experience

Choosing the Right Digital Calendar Tool

To select the most suitable digital calendar tool, consider the following factors:

  • User Interface: A user-friendly interface is essential for team collaboration. Look for tools with a clean and intuitive design that allows team members to easily navigate and access information.
  • Integrations: Consider the types of integrations the tool offers, such as calendar sharing, task assignment, and file sharing.
  • Scalability: Choose a tool that can handle growing team sizes and changing project needs.

Examples of Digital Calendar Tools

There are several digital calendar tools available that offer collaborative features, including:

  1. Google Calendar: Google Calendar is a popular choice for team collaboration, offering features such as shared calendars, reminders, and integration with other Google apps.
  2. Microsoft Outlook: Microsoft Outlook offers a range of collaborative features, including shared calendars, task assignment, and integration with Microsoft Teams.
